Output e870b5b1311f5ec6fba4396cfbc27989c6e2df4028756ddfd2ddd313b7a7c775:0

value
539062
script pubkey
OP_0 OP_PUSHBYTES_20 8c3a117b26e9e426540eacdce8dd044d80bc1fc7
address
bc1q3sapz7exa8jzv4qw4nww3hgyfkqtc878m0ax7z
transaction
e870b5b1311f5ec6fba4396cfbc27989c6e2df4028756ddfd2ddd313b7a7c775